Market Performance shows brand’s share of foot traffic, revealing competitive strength and customer preference in the industry.
PizzaForno has a Market Performance percentile of 80, placing it as an average/above average performer. This indicates a solid market standing relative to competitors. Performance peers include Spolumbo's, Indian Spoon, Hap's Hungry House, B Burger, Pignon Rouge and New King Shawarma Plus, all with a percentile of 80.
Customer satisfaction reflects brand perception and loyalty. High satisfaction scores often correlate with repeat business and positive word-of-mouth.
PizzaForno's overall customer satisfaction is 73%, a 14 percentage point increase year-over-year. In Ontario, customer satisfaction is also at 73%, with a substantial increase of 22 percentage points. This indicates improved customer experiences and strong regional performance.
Number of outlets indicates brand reach and market presence. Growth in outlet count signifies expansion and increased accessibility.
PizzaForno has 27 outlets in Canada, with 21 located in Ontario, 2 in British Columbia, 2 in Alberta, 1 in Manitoba, and 1 in Quebec. Ontario represents the largest market share, suggesting a strong regional focus.
Understanding competitors helps refine strategies. Analyzing cross-visitation patterns reveals shared customer preferences.
The top competitors based on cross-visitation are Yasmin Al cham Laval, La Diperie, Tim Hortons, Dairy Queen, and 3 Cows & A Cone Inc., each with a cross-visitation rate of 10%. This indicates these brands share a portion of PizzaForno's customer base.
Traffic workload analysis reveals peak hours, enabling optimized staffing and resource allocation for better customer service.
PizzaForno experiences varying traffic workloads throughout the day, with peak hours occurring between 17:00 and 22:00. Traffic workload ranged from 37.44 to 45.33, suggesting need for optimized staffing during peak.
Consumer segments enable targeted marketing. Gender and generation analysis informs tailored messaging and product development.
Women index at 88, indicating they are under-indexed compared to the average consumer. Men index at 108, showing a slightly over-indexed affinity. Gen X consumers index at 74, suggesting they are under-indexed. Gen Y consumers index at 142, indicating a high affinity for PizzaForno.
